Appropriate Preposition:

  • Prefer to ( অধিক পছন্দ করা ) I prefer coffee to tea.
  • Due to ( কারণে ) His absence is due to illness.
  • Plead for ( ওকালতি করা (কোনকিছু) ) I pleaded with him for justice (against the wrong done to me).
  • Responsible for ( দায়ী (কোন কার্জ) ) He is responsible to the committee for his action.
  • Rob of ( অপহরণ করা ) Somebody robbed him of his purse.
  • Subject to ( শর্তাধীন ) This is subject to approval of the committee.

Idioms:

  • Make both ends meet ( আয়ব্যয় মেলানো ) I cannot make both ends meet with my small income.
  • under the weather ( ভাল না ; অসুস্থ ) I've been feeling under the weather
  • Apple of discord ( বিবাদেয় বিষয় ) The paternal property has become an apple of discord between the two brothers.
  • Build castles in the air ( আকাশ কুসুম চিন্তা করা ) Don't idle away your time in building castles in the air.
  • bad faith ( বিশ্বাসঘাতকতা )
  • At a low ebb ( নিম্নমুখী ) His fame is at a low ebb now.

Bangla to English Expressions (Translations):

  • তোমাকে নিয়ে ভাবছি - TOY: Thinking of you
  • মে মাসের মধ্যভাগে - In the middle of May
  • তিনি বাড়ি এলেই আমি বের হব - I will go out as soon as he comes home
  • ভদ্র লোকটি মাথা নেড়ে সম্মতি দিলেন - The gentle man nodded assent
  • চোরটিকে ছেড়ে দেব আন পুলিশের হাতে দেব? - Shall I let the thief go, or hand him over to the police
  • তুমি কি এটা আগে করেছ? - Have you done this before?
